Output 39ba26bbe2883a3d437672ceb3698491a57e2213105a6312de48490f4e0eca57:1

value
20356272
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0cdec646dd38a7a2a72ba600db6c6f3a76e1284 OP_EQUALVERIFY OP_CHECKSIG
address
1L34EiB8ZAMGpdky9dRTVpvub6SkChAHKa
transaction
39ba26bbe2883a3d437672ceb3698491a57e2213105a6312de48490f4e0eca57
spent
true